Nitrogen transport and transformations in a coastal plain watershed: Influence of geomorphology on flow paths and residence times

January 1, 2005

Nitrogen transport and groundwater‐surface water interactions were examined in a coastal plain watershed in the southeastern United States. Groundwater age dates, calculated using chlorofluorocarbon and tritium concentrations, along with concentrations of nitrogen species and other redox‐active constituents, were used to evaluate the fate and transport of nitrate.
